Existence and regularity for integro‐differential free transmission problem

open access: yesBulletin of the London Mathematical Society, Volume 57, Issue 7, Page 1923-1937, July 2025.
Abstract We study an integro‐differential free transmission problem associated with the Bellman–Isaacs‐type operator that is solution‐dependent. The existence of a viscosity solution is proved by constructing solutions of suitable auxiliary problems for such a nonlocal problem.

On the isoperimetric Riemannian Penrose inequality

open access: yesCommunications on Pure and Applied Mathematics, Volume 78, Issue 5, Page 1042-1085, May 2025.
Abstract We prove that the Riemannian Penrose inequality holds for asymptotically flat 3‐manifolds with nonnegative scalar curvature and connected horizon boundary, provided the optimal decay assumptions are met, which result in the ADM$\operatorname{ADM}$ mass being a well‐defined geometric invariant.

The Exterior Problem of Parabolic Hessian Quotient Equations

open access: yesMathematics
In this paper, we investigate the exterior problem of parabolic Hessian quotient equations. By utilizing Perron’s method, we establish the existence of viscosity solutions that exhibit generalized asymptotic behavior at infinity.
